Post by Christine Onyango 1 »

The insight that the author has on our psychological being is very diverse. Honestly, until this book I never knew that self-help books could become the guide to 'self-harm' that we were avoiding in the first place. The way the author explains how the mental space works is not only interesting but also helpful. I especially liked how he explained The Intruder, which is a personification of the harm that we do to ourselves, thinking that we are doing right by ourselves. The book is totally a must read.
